In an interview given to Politico MP Bourgeois has set out his vision on the European Commission’s proposal on the next Multiannual Financial Framework (MFF) for the period 2021-2027.
MP Bourgeois calls for an ambitious, modern and realistic budget that reflects policy choices. His number one priority for the next MFF is research, development and innovation driven by excellence. He also stresses the need for investments in transport, energy and digitalization and for greater efforts in the field of defense and the safeguarding of international stability. A significant cut in cohesion policy spending is necessary according to MP Bourgeois, but investments in human capital via the European Social Fund and investments in cross-border cooperation via the European Fund for Regional Development have added value. The common agricultural policy should be modernized, including more member state implementing powers. MP Bourgeois calls for a fund in the EU budget to support countries around the North Sea with an expected significant negative impact from Brexit on their economies.
